严寒地区土壤源热泵系统的运行性能分析 被引量:17

Simulation Analysis on Operating Performance of GCHP in Severe Cold Area

摘要 本文针对沈阳市1栋典型办公建筑,首先采用TRNSYS软件建立了土壤源热泵系统与常规冷热源系统的模型,并进行了全年动态能耗模拟,通过模拟发现土壤源热泵系统在该地区的运行状态比较稳定。而后,将土壤源热泵系统与常规冷热源系统进行比较,从节能效益方面分析了土壤源热泵系统在该地区应用的可行性。 In this paper,taking a typical office building in Shenyang as an example,models of ground couple heat pump (GCHP) system and conventional system by the software of TRNSYS were established, and the annual dynamic energy consumption was simulated. It was observed that the operating situation was stable. Furthermore, GCHP system was compared with conventional system from the aspect of energy efficiency and the feasibility of applying GCHP system in this area was analyzed.
